When you execute the program, you specify the class that contains the main method and then command line arguments. args [0] is the first command line argument. You need to provide it when you run the program. where A is args [0], B is args [1] and C is args [2]. And, you can use args.length to see how many arguments were given.

WebWithin f () the argument t is always an lvalue as it has a name. Thus, calling a function from f () with the argument will not consider the argument to be an rvalue. If you want to forward the argument and retain its properties as in the original call, you'll need to use std::forward (): g (std::forward (t));

WebOct 25, 2024 · 1 Answer. Sorted by: 5. Generally, using str (e) would be safer because there are cases where e.args [0] can raise an index error: try: raise Exception () except Exception as e: value = e.args [0] >>> IndexError: tuple index out of range.
